Peugeot-2021-New-Black.pngKeep an Extra Car Key With You in Case You Lose Yours

A spare car key is a good idea. Place it in a secure location to avoid having to call locksmiths or roadside assistance if you lose keys.

A mechanical key can be replaced at a hardware store by a locksmith or a dealership. A transponder or smart key, however, will need to be connected to your vehicle's immobilizer through the dealership.

Cost

There are ways to reduce the cost of losing your car keys. The cheapest option is to find an auto locksmith who specializes in your car. They will have all the equipment needed to replace your key and they can also provide other services such as lock repair and installation. Roadside assistance or getting an alternative key from your insurance provider are also affordable alternatives. These options could come with restrictions and conditions, however.

The cost of a replacement car key is contingent on the type of key and the location it is stolen or lost. If you own an ordinary car key, your only cost is the price of the new key fob. If you have transponder keys or a smart key the cost will be significantly more expensive. Smart keys are proximity sensor-based key that can unlock your doors and start the car at the touch of the button. These keys are more expensive than traditional keys because they have to be programmed and trained to work with your car.

To get a replacement key, you'll need the vehicle Identification Number (VIN). This number can be located on the paperwork for your vehicle or through a free VIN search tool on the internet. The VIN is a 17-digit number that is used to identify the model and make of your vehicle. If you don't have your VIN other information could be used to identify your vehicle. For example the type of engine and the year of manufacture.

You may also search for a spare not manufactured by the same company that made your original key. This will be an extended and time-consuming process. You may be able to purchase a generic key online for less than what you would pay at your dealer. This is only a possibility for cars that have unlocked trunks, since it will not allow you to use the power door locks or the alarm system.

If you lose your car keys, it's important to keep a spare in a safe place. A spare key can save you from the hassle and cost of contacting a dealership particularly if your local locksmith does not have the necessary programming tools for your particular vehicle.

Security

It wasn't so long ago that losing your car keys or losing keys was not a big deal. You could visit a locksmith or dealership and have keys replaced without a lot of hassle. As automobiles have technologically advanced, replacing keys is becoming more difficult.

The first thing to do is determine what kind of key you have. You can find this information by looking up the VIN (vehicle ID number) of your vehicle. This is a 17-digit code that contains numbers and letters but not the letters I, O and Q. It can also be located on the back of your vehicle's registration or title. This number is unique to the vehicle and you'll need it if you want to have your new key reprogrammed to work with the car.

The majority of cars are equipped with transponder keys which look similar to traditional keys but contain a chip in the handle which communicates with the car's security system. This feature can help reduce theft by making it difficult to start the vehicle without the use of a key. This kind of key is more complex and is more difficult to duplicate so you will need to locate a locksmith who is professional and has the right tools.

You can also use bags or boxes made by Faraday for your key fobs. These devices separate the key's frequency from outside sources, which makes it difficult for thieves to duplicate them. The devices can be bought at the hardware store in your area for around $20 or online. This method isn't foolproof.

You'll need to take your smart keys to a manufacturer or dealer to replace it. They have proximity sensors that let you unlock your car and then start it by pressing one button. These keys are more expensive to replace as they require special tools and knowledge.

A professional locksmith will be able create a replacement for you however, they may need erase the current programming from the car's system to do this. This can be done by following the instructions in your owner's manual.

Time is a factor.

You can keep spare keys in your car in case you lose your original. However the time required to get them can vary dependent on the vehicle model and key type. Making a standard key is easy and cost-effective. You can also make it at your local hardware shop. If you have to have a key fob or transponder chip replaced, the process may take more time.

You can either go through a locksmith, which is a more expensive option, or you can get one from a dealer. Both options can be used to replace the lost key. However the dealer has the most experience programming the new key so that it works with your vehicle. The dealer will also be able to access to your vehicle's security systems which can stop theft.

Another option is to purchase an unprogrammed key replacement for car online and have it programmed by a locksmith. This is a risky choice as you might end up with a wrong key that won't work for your vehicle. Additionally, the key needs to be programmed to your vehicle using the information found on your VIN. This information can be found on your car's title or registration.

If you require replacement of your car key in a hurry and need to replace your car key, you can contact an emergency roadside service or look for a locksmith in the automotive industry near you. Finding the right service can help you save money and time in the long run. You can also reach out to your insurance company for additional savings on this service. But, it is important to note that this option will not cover all car repair costs. It is important to check the terms and conditions of your service provider to learn more. It is recommended to purchase an auto replacement car keys price key before you lose it, as this will minimize the costs and difficulties of replacing it. This will also help you save a lot of time.

Safety

Car keys can be a big source of frustration for many people. Sometimes they get lost car key replacement near Me, while at other times, they fail or break until they stop functioning properly. This is why it is essential to take the time to perform regular maintenance on your key fob. You can be certain that it will function correctly whenever you need it to. Keep a spare key with you to ensure that you are able to continue driving even if the key fob malfunctions.

There are various ways to obtain a new car key replacement replacement car key dependent on the type of key you have. You can get the traditional key cylinder key from a locksmith in your area, for example. These keys are usually less expensive and resemble your old car replacement keys key. These keys do not contain chips and therefore can't be used to unlock your car or start the motor. You can also visit your dealer to purchase an alternative key. They will have the tools to repair the cut of the key and program it so that it activates the security systems in your car.

Transponder chips can fail and cause your car to not respond to the new key. This is a common issue for older vehicles, and it can occur when the key fob has been damaged by water or other extreme conditions. To resolve this issue it is possible to go to a reputable locksmith and replace the chip. A reliable auto locksmith will locate the code for your vehicle and replace the chip without having to disassemble the lock.

You can also replace the part yourself if know how to use the tools and have the appropriate ones. This method is risky therefore, it's best to let a professional. If you're tech-savvy, you can also look up online tutorials to learn how to do the job yourself. This is an easy and cost-effective alternative to calling the locksmith or dealership.
